Output 745de03abb3be61a24bad7f44d5ccaaa3d16338cb60f655d6a2050907e0ce38e:1

value
12521836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a65dfa42fd47925c224393705bfa8d038c604047 OP_EQUAL
address
3Grgg4hmYjVX5hBw759HyCV5cPmQ1n1xcx
transaction
745de03abb3be61a24bad7f44d5ccaaa3d16338cb60f655d6a2050907e0ce38e
spent
true